Understanding CBD E-cigarette Regulations in Saudi Arabia
The regulatory landscape surrounding CBD e-cigarette use in Saudi Arabia remains challenging and subject to frequent changes. While CBD derived from the technical hemp plant containing less than trace amounts THC is technically tolerated for certain industrial applications, its presence in e-cigarette products is a murky zone. Importing inhalation devices containing CBD is generally prohibited, and even possession or use, while not explicitly criminalized in all scenarios, carries significant potential consequences due to the broad interpretation of narcotics laws. It is essential that individuals thoroughly investigate the most recent rulings from the Saudi Food and Drug Authority (SFDA) and consult with specialized lawyers before engaging in any activity related to CBD vaping to avoid unexpected legal repercussions. Penalties for non-compliance can be substantial and may include fines, arrest, and deportation from the country.
